Output dd523715436fee4c535dc8f791d3b27c4db1b9d8579fe18981784d1030f4ccc3:1

value
50843943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66fec46cd74f1ef090e0dae210a5c37ac16daf7d OP_EQUAL
address
3B5c3ekuyvYyy1EtW7UaydBibSNMEAt3qZ
transaction
dd523715436fee4c535dc8f791d3b27c4db1b9d8579fe18981784d1030f4ccc3
spent
true